This week we are featuring one of our flexible packaging products, the CLAF® Bio Fabric™ Mesh Bag. It is an open mesh nonwoven made with renewable raw materials derived from sugarcane.

Sustainably Made Open Mesh

Consumer demand is rising for environmentally responsible and sustainable products, including packaging, reinforcement, and industrial laminating materials that are equally eco-friendly. CLAF® Bio Fabric™ is an open mesh nonwoven made with resins derived from renewably sourced sugarcane.

Not only does sugarcane capture CO2 as it grows, but unlike oil and natural gas, sugarcane is renewable because it regenerates quickly. This material has physical and chemical properties that are similar to petroleum-based plastic, but the process of making it is more sustainable.

As certified on its USDA BioPreferred® Product label, CLAF® Bio Fabric™ is derived from 96% plant-based materials. It is strong, breathable, and has unique properties that raise it above other open mesh products. And like the original CLAF®, this mesh is also available in multiple colors.

Sustainability

CLAF® Bio Fabric™ contains 96% biobased content, which is the percentage ratio of non-fossil organic carbon. It highly exceeds the minimum standard of 25% set by the USDA BioPreferred® Program for biobased products. It is made with resins based on sugarcane, a highly renewable resource. It is also 100% recyclable and is compatible with the current polyethylene recycle stream.
